  3. Anonymous users2024-02-03

    Let the radius of the bottom circle be r, and the full area = the sum of the areas of the two bottom circles + the side area. That is, 2 r + 2 r 8 = 130, the solution.

    r=5 or r=-13 (round), so the radius of the bottom circle is 5cm, and the volume = the height of the base area, that is, v=s h= r h=25 8=200 (cm).
